OSDN Git Service

* gcc.dg/nested-func-1.c: New test.
[pf3gnuchains/gcc-fork.git] / gcc / testsuite / ChangeLog
index 3f00636..f200f42 100644 (file)
@@ -1,3 +1,345 @@
+2003-11-18  Joseph S. Myers  <jsm@polyomino.org.uk>
+
+       * gcc.dg/nested-func-1.c: New test.
+
+2003-11-16  Kaveh R. Ghazi  <ghazi@caip.rutgers.edu>
+
+       * gcc.dg/cpp/assert4.c: New test.
+
+2003-11-14  Giovanni Bajo  <giovannibajo@libero.it>
+
+        PR c++/2294
+        * g++.dg/lookup/using9.c: New test.
+
+2003-11-14  Mark Mitchell  <mark@codesourcery.com>
+
+       PR c++/12762
+       * g++.dg/template/error3.C: New test.
+
+2003-11-14  Arnaud Charlet  <charlet@act-europe.fr>
+
+       PR ada/13035
+       * ada/acats/run_acats, run_all.sh: Fix syntax error.
+       No longer use a wrapper for gcc, since this does not work under
+       Windows.
+
+2003-11-14  Giovanni Bajo  <giovannibajo@libero.it>
+
+        PR c++/2094
+        * g++.dg/template/ptrmem7.C: New test.
+
+2003-11-13  Andrew Pinski <apinski@apple.com>
+
+       * gcc.c-torture/compile/20031113-1.c: New test.
+
+2003-11-13  Mark Mitchell  <mark@codesourcery.com>
+            Kean Johnston <jkj@sco.com>
+
+       PR c/13029
+       * gcc.dg/unused-4.c: Update.
+
+2003-11-13  Eric Botcazou  <ebotcazou@libertysurf.fr>
+
+       * g++.dg/opt/const3.C: New test.
+
+2003-11-13  Jan Hubicka  <jh@suse.cz>
+
+       * gcc.c-torture/compile/20031112-1.c: New test.
+
+2003-11-12  Mark Mitchell  <mark@codesourcery.com>
+
+       * g++.dg/parse/crash10.C: Remove bogus error marker.
+
+2003-11-12  Rainer Orth  <ro@TechFak.Uni-Bielefeld.DE>
+
+       * ada/acats/run_acats (host_gnatmake): Use type in a /bin/sh script.
+       (host_gcc): Likewise.
+       (ROOT): Honor $PWDCMD.
+       (BASE): Likewise.
+       * ada/acats/run_all.sh (dir): Honor $PWDCMD.
+
+2003-11-12  Catherine Moore  <clm@redhat.com>
+
+       * gcc.c-torture/execute/20020720-1.x:  Add xfail for frv-*-*.
+
+2003-11-12  Andreas Jaeger  <aj@suse.de>
+           Jakub Jelinek  <jakub@redhat.com>
+           Andrew Pinski  <pinskia@physics.uc.edu>
+           Richard Henderson  <rth@redhat.com>
+
+       * gcc.dg/c90-const-expr-2.c (foo): Avoid extra warning on 64-bit
+       systems.
+       * gcc.dg/c99-const-expr-2.c (foo): Likewise.
+
+       * gcc.dg/20030926-1.c: Make it work on x86_64 systems.
+       * gcc.dg/i386-pentium4-not-mull.c: Likewise.
+
+2003-11-11  Andreas Jaeger  <aj@suse.de>
+
+       * gcc.c-torture/execute/20020720-1.x: Test passes also on x86_64.
+
+       * gcc.c-torture/execute/20020227-1.x: Test passes also on x86_64.
+
+2003-11-10  Arnaud Charlet  <charlet@act-europe.fr>
+
+       * ada/acats/run_all.sh: Add handling of unsupported (tasking) tests.
+       Clean ups.
+
+2003-11-10  Waldek Hebisch  <hebisch@math.uni.wroc.pl>
+
+       * gcc.dg/trampoline-1.c: New test.
+
+2003-11-09  Andrew Pinski  <pinskia@physics.uc.edu>
+
+       * gcc.c-torture/compile/200031109-1.c: New test.
+
+2003-11-08  Joseph S. Myers  <jsm@polyomino.org.uk>
+
+       PR c/3190
+       PR c/8714
+       * gcc.dg/format/c90-strftime-1.c, gcc.dg/format/c90-strftime-2.c,
+       gcc.dg/format/c99-strftime-1.c, gcc.dg/format/ext3.c,
+       gcc.dg/format/no-y2k-1.c: Update.
+
+2003-11-08  Roger Sayle  <roger@eyesopen.com>
+
+       PR optimization/10467
+       * gcc.dg/20031108-1.c: New test case.
+
+2003-11-07  Geoffrey Keating  <geoffk@apple.com>
+
+       * gcc.dg/pch/warn-1.c: Allow for more helpful error message.
+
+2003-11-08  Joseph S. Myers  <jsm@polyomino.org.uk>
+
+       * gcc.dg/compound-lvalue-1.c: New test.
+       * gcc.dg/c90-const-expr-2.c, gcc.dg/c99-const-expr-2.c: Remove
+       some XFAILs.
+
+2003-11-06  Geoffrey Keating  <geoffk@apple.com>
+
+       * gcc.dg/altivec-varargs-1.c: New test.
+
+2003-11-05  Eric Botcazou  <ebotcazou@libertysurf.fr>
+
+       * gcc.c-torture/compile/20031023-4.c: XFAIL on SPARC64
+       * gcc.c-torture/compile/simd-5.c: XFAIL on SPARC64 at -O0 and -O1.
+       * gcc.c-torture/execute/simd-4.x: New file.  XFAIL on SPARC at -O0.
+       * gcc.c-torture/execute/va-arg-25.x: New file.  XFAIL on SPARC.
+       * gcc.dg/uninit-C.c: XFAIL on non 64-bit Solaris versions.
+
+2003-11-05  Joseph S. Myers  <jsm@polyomino.org.uk>
+
+       * gcc.dg/cond-lvalue-1.c: New test.
+
+2003-11-05  Gernot Hillier  <gernot.hillier@siemens.com>
+
+       * g++.old-deja/g++.pt/asm1.C: Enable for e.g. x86_64-*-linux-gnu.
+
+2003-11-05  Kriang Lerdsuwanakij  <lerdsuwa@users.sourceforge.net>
+
+       PR c++/11616
+       * g++.dg/template/instantiate5.C: New test.
+
+2003-11-03  Volker Reichelt  <reichelt@igpm.rwth-aachen.de>
+
+       PR c++/12726
+       * g++.dg/ext/complit2.C: Replace test with self-contained version.
+       * ChangeLog: Add missing first entry for above test.
+
+2003-11-02  Kriang Lerdsuwanakij  <lerdsuwa@users.sourceforge.net>
+
+       PR c++/9810
+       * g++.dg/template/using8.C: New test.
+       * g++.old-deja/g++.other/access11.C: Adjust expected error location.
+
+2003-11-02  Roger Sayle  <roger@eyesopen.com>
+
+       PR optimization/10817
+       * gcc.c-torture/compile/20031102-1.c: New test case.
+
+2003-11-02  Kazu Hirata  <kazu@cs.umass.edu>
+
+       * gcc.c-torture/execute/va-arg-25.c: Enable only if INT_MAX ==
+       2147483647.
+
+2003-11-02  Eric Botcazou  <ebotcazou@libertysurf.fr>
+
+       * gcc.dg/20031102-1.c: New test.
+
+2003-11-02  Eric Botcazou  <ebotcazou@libertysurf.fr>
+
+       * gcc.dg/complex-1.c: New test.
+
+2003-11-01  Kriang Lerdsuwanakij  <lerdsuwa@users.sourceforge.net>
+
+       PR c++/12796
+       * g++.dg/template/crash13.C: Adjust expected error location.
+       * g++.old-deja/g++.brendan/ns1.C: Likewise.
+
+2003-10-31  Richard Earnshaw  <rearnsha@arm.com>
+
+       * g++.dg/bprob/bprob.exp: Disable test on arm-elf configs.
+
+2003-10-31  Josef Zlomek  <zlomekj@suse.cz>
+
+       PR/10239
+       * gcc.c-torture/compile/20031031-2.c: New test.
+
+2003-10-31  Josef Zlomek  <zlomekj@suse.cz>
+
+       PR/11640
+       * gcc.c-torture/compile/20031031-1.c: New test.
+
+2003-10-31  Richard Earnshaw  <rearnsha@arm.com>
+
+       * g77.dg/bprob/bprob.exp: Disable test on arm-elf configs.
+       * gcc.misc-tests/bprob.exp: Likewise.
+       * g77.dg/execute/20001201.x, 6367.x, io0.x, io1.x, u77-test.x: XFAIL
+       the execution test on arm-elf configs.
+       * g77.dg/execute/10197.x: New file.  XFAIL the execution test on
+       configs that don't support scratch files.
+       * g77.dg/execute/u77-test.x: XFAIL compilation on arm-elf configs.
+
+2003-10-30  Arnaud Charlet  <charlet@act-europe.fr>
+
+       * ada/acats/run_all.sh: Do not print PASS messages to stdout, as
+       done by dejagnu.
+
+2003-10-29  Arnaud Charlet  <charlet@act-europe.fr>
+
+       * ada/acats/run_all.sh: Redirect mv output to /dev/null
+       Avoid non pure sh syntax. Add more logging.
+
+       * ada/acats/norun.lst: Disable cdd2a03, since it is expected to
+       fail.
+
+2003-10-28  Franz Sirl  <Franz.Sirl-kernel@lauterbach.com>
+
+       PR libgcj/10610
+       * gcc.dg/ppc-stackalign-1.c: New test.
+
+2003-10-28  Arnaud Charlet  <charlet@act-europe.fr>
+
+       * ada/acats/run_all.sh: Change output to be more compliant with
+       dejagnu framework.
+       Create acats.sum and acats.log files under testsuite/ada/acats
+       Only run [a-z]* directories, to filter out e.g. CVS.
+       Redirect build output to log file.
+
+2003-10-27  Arnaud Charlet  <charlet@act-europe.fr>
+
+       * README.ada: Removed, integrated in ../doc/sourcebuild.texi
+
+2003-10-27  Arnaud Charlet  <charlet@act-europe.fr>
+
+       PR ada/5909:
+       * README.ada, ada/acats: Import ACATS 2.5 for GCC Ada test suite.
+
+2003-10-27  Jakub Jelinek  <jakub@redhat.com>
+
+       * gcc.c-torture/compile/20031023-1.c: New test.
+       * gcc.c-torture/compile/20031023-2.c: New test.
+       * gcc.c-torture/compile/20031023-3.c: New test.
+       * gcc.c-torture/compile/20031023-4.c: New test.
+
+2003-10-26  Kriang Lerdsuwanakij  <lerdsuwa@users.sourceforge.net>
+
+       PR c++/10371
+       * g++.dg/lookup/scoped8.C: New test.
+
+2003-10-25  Eric Botcazou  <ebotcazou@libertysurf.fr>
+
+       * g++.dg/opt/reg-stack3.C: New test.
+
+2003-10-24  Joseph S. Myers  <jsm@polyomino.org.uk>
+
+       * gcc.dg/c99-arraydecl-2.c: New test.  PR c/11943.
+
+2003-10-24  Kriang Lerdsuwanakij  <lerdsuwa@users.sourceforge.net>
+
+       PR c++/11076
+       * g++.dg/template/crash13.C: New test.
+
+2003-10-24  Joseph S. Myers  <jsm@polyomino.org.uk>
+
+       * gcc.dg/c99-restrict-2.c: New test.
+
+2003-10-24  Nathan Sidwell  <nathan@codesourcery.com>
+
+       PR c++/12698, c++/12699, c++/12700, c++/12566
+       * g++.dg/inherit/covariant9.C: New test.
+       * g++.dg/inherit/covariant10.C: New test.
+       * g++.dg/inherit/covariant11.C: New test.
+
+2003-10-23  Jason Merrill  <jason@redhat.com>
+
+       PR c++/12726
+       * g++.dg/ext/complit2.C: New test.
+
+2003-10-20  Falk Hueffner  <falk.hueffner@student.uni-tuebingen.de>
+
+       PR target/12654
+       * gcc.c-torture/execute/20031020-1.c: New test.
+
+2003-10-20  Zdenek Dvorak  <rakdver@atrey.karlin.mff.cuni.cz>
+
+       * gcc.dg/old-style-asm-1.c: Also check for (set (pc) on lines
+       following the jump_insn.
+
+2003-10-22  Joseph S. Myers  <jsm@polyomino.org.uk>
+
+       * gcc.dg/cast-lvalue-1.c: New test.
+
+2003-10-21  Mark Mitchell  <mark@codesourcery.com>
+
+       PR c++/11962
+       * g++.dg/template/cond2.C: New test.
+
+2003-10-20  Joseph S. Myers  <jsm@polyomino.org.uk>
+
+       * gcc.dg/builtins-28.c: New test.
+
+2003-10-20  Jan Hubicka  <jh@suse.cz>
+
+       * testsuite/g++.dg/opt/inline4.C: Do not use min-inline-insns
+       parameter.
+       * testsuite/gcc.dg/inline-2.c: Likewise.
+
+2003-10-20  Phil Edwards  <phil@codesourcery.com>
+
+       * gcc.dg/20021014-1.c:  XFAIL for *-*-windiss targets.
+       * gcc.dg/nest.c:  Likewise.
+
+2003-10-20  Kriang Lerdsuwanakij  <lerdsuwa@users.sourceforge.net>
+
+       PR c++/9781, c++/10583, c++/11862
+       * g++.dg/parse/crash13.C: New test.
+
+2003-10-20  Zdenek Dvorak  <rakdver@atrey.karlin.mff.cuni.cz>
+
+       * gcc.dg/old-style-asm-1.c: Count jump_insns instead of labels.
+
+2003-10-20  Eric Botcazou  <ebotcazou@libertysurf.fr>
+
+       * gcc.dg/builtins-18.c: Wrap C99 tests with HAVE_C99_RUNTIME.
+       Define HAVE_C99_RUNTIME except on Solaris.
+       * gcc.dg/builtins-20.c: Likewise.
+
+2003-10-19  Zdenek Dvorak  <rakdver@atrey.karlin.mff.cuni.cz>
+
+       * gcc.dg/old-style-asm-1.c: Use scan-assembler-times.
+
+2003-10-18  Kriang Lerdsuwanakij  <lerdsuwa@users.sourceforge.net>
+
+       PR c++/12495
+       * g++.dg/template/crash21.C: New test.
+
+2003-10-17  Kriang Lerdsuwanakij  <lerdsuwa@users.sourceforge.net>
+
+       PR c++/2513
+       * g++.dg/template/typename5.C: New test.
+
 2003-10-17  Kriang Lerdsuwanakij  <lerdsuwa@users.sourceforge.net>
 
        PR c++/12369
        objc.dg/try-catch-4.m: Run on non-Darwin targets.
        * objc.dg/zero-link-2.m: Remove blank line.
        * objc.dg/zero-link-3.m: New test case.
-       
+
 2003-10-13  Geoffrey Keating  <geoffk@apple.com>
 
        * g77.f-torture/execute/980520-1.x: XFAIL at -O0.
        PR c++/10147
        * g++.dg/other/error4.C: Update error messages.
        * g++.dg/template/ptrmem4.C: Likewise.
-       
+
        PR c++/12337
        * g++.dg/init/new9.C: New test.
-       
+
        PR c++/12334, c++/12236, c++/8656
        * g++.dg/ext/attrib8.C: New test.
 
 
        * gcc.dg/debug/dwarf2-3.h: New test.
        * gcc.dg/debug/dwarf2-3.c: New test case for -feliminate-dwarf2-dups.
-       
+
 2003-10-06  Wolfgang Bangerth  <bangerth@ticam.utexas.edu>
 
        * g++.dg/opt/cfg2.C: New test.
        objc.dg/method-{1-2}.m, objc.dg/proto-hier-1.m,
        objc.dg/proto-lossage-1.m: Adjust for message wording changes.
        * objc.dg/const-str-1.m: Fix constant string layout.
+
 2003-09-24  Alexandre Oliva  <aoliva@redhat.com>
 
        * gcc.dg/cpp/Wunknown-pragmas-1.c: New test.
 2003-09-09  Devang Patel  <dpatel@apple.com>
 
        * gcc.dg/darwin-ld-6.c: New test.
-       
+
 2003-09-09  Kaveh R. Ghazi  <ghazi@caip.rutgers.edu>
 
        * gcc.dg/torture/builtin-explog-1.c: New testcase.
 
        PR c++/11507
        * g++.dg/lookup/scoped7.C: New test.
+
        PR c++/9574
        * g++.dg/other/static1.C: New test.
 
 
        PR c++/11432
        * g++.dg/template/crash10.C: New test.
+
        PR c++/2478
        * g++.dg/overload/VLA.C: New test.
+
        PR c++/10804
        * g++.dg/template/call1.C: New test.
 
 
 2003-09-05  Andrew Pinski  <pinskia@physics.uc.edu>
 
-       * g++.old-deja/g++.ext/pretty2.C: Update for change 
+       * g++.old-deja/g++.ext/pretty2.C: Update for change
        in __FUNCTION__.
        * g++.old-deja/g++.ext/pretty3.C: Likewise.
 
 
        PR c++/11922
        * g++/dg/template/qualified-id1.C: New test.
-       
+
        PR c++/12037
        * g++.dg/warn/noeffect4.C: New test.
 
        * g++.dg/ext/fnname1.C: New test. (__func__ for C++.)
        * g++.dg/ext/fnname2.C: Likewise.
        * g++.dg/ext/fnname3.C: Likewise.
-       
+
 2003-09-04  Mark Mitchell  <mark@codesourcery.com>
 
        * g++.dg/expr/lval1.C: New test.
 
        PR c++/11553
        * g++.dg/parse/friend3.C: New test.
-       
+
 2003-09-02  Mark Mitchell  <mark@codesourcery.com>
 
        PR c++/11847
 
        PR c++/11670
        * g++.dg/expr/cast2.C: New test.
-       
+
        PR c++/10530
        * g++.dg/template/dependent-name2.C: New test.
 
        * gcc.dg/torture/builtin-math-1.c: New test taken from
        bits of gcc.dg/builtins-3.c, gcc.dg/builtins-5.c and also some
        additional cases.
-       
+
        * gcc.dg/builtins-3.c, gcc.dg/builtins-4.c, gcc.dg/builtins-5.c:
        Delete.
 
        * gcc.dg/tls/opt-7.c: New test.
 
 2003-07-31  Andrew Pinski  <pinskia@physics.uc.edu>
-       
+
        * g++.old-deja/g++.other/crash18.C: Remove.
 
 2003-07-31  Nathan Sidwell  <nathan@codesourcery.com>
 
 2003-06-03  Glen Nakamura  <glen@imodulo.com>
 
-       * gcc.dg/20020525-1.c: Replace 0x5a5a5a5a with -1.
+       * gcc.dg/20020525-1.c: Replace 0x5a5a5a5a with -1.
 
 2003-06-03  J"orn Rennecke <joern.rennecke@superh.com>
 
 
 2002-10-21  Mark Mitchell  <mark@codesourcery.com>
 
-       * g++.dg/init/array6.C: Add additional tests.
+       * g++.dg/init/array6.C: Add additional tests.
 
 2002-10-21  Ulrich Weigand  <uweigand@de.ibm.com>